Boosting Team Performance with Project Time Tracking

One of the core benefits of implementing a dedicated time tracking solution is the ability to accurately measure project costs. Labor is often a significant component of project expenses, and precise time records are essential for accurate billing and profitability analysis. When team members consistently track their time against specific projects and tasks, businesses gain a detailed understanding of where their resources are being invested. This visibility enables informed decision-making regarding future project bids, resource allocation, and overall financial planning. Moreover, detailed time tracking data can highlight areas where efficiency can be improved, leading to reduced costs and increased profitability. It enables project managers to identify tasks taking longer than anticipated and investigate the root causes, potentially uncovering training needs or process inefficiencies.

The Impact of Granular Data

The power of robust time tracking lies in its granularity. Instead of simply logging the total hours worked on a project, the ability to categorize time by specific tasks, sub-tasks, or even client engagements provides a much more nuanced understanding of workflow. This detailed breakdown allows for more accurate project costing, better resource management, and improved client communication. For example, a marketing agency can accurately bill clients based on the time spent on specific campaign elements, such as content creation, social media management, or ad campaign optimization. Similarly, a software development company can track the time invested in different phases of a project, from requirements gathering to testing and deployment, providing valuable data for future project estimates and resource allocation. This level of detail fosters accountability and transparency, building trust with both clients and internal stakeholders.

Improving Accountability and Transparency

Accountability is a cornerstone of successful project management. When team members are aware that their time is being tracked, they are more likely to stay focused and on task. A transparent time tracking system also helps to identify and address any discrepancies in work effort, ensuring that everyone is contributing their fair share. This transparency can also be extended to clients, providing them with a clear understanding of how their project budgets are being utilized. Regular reports detailing time spent on specific tasks and deliverables can build trust and demonstrate the value of your services. Moreover, detailed time tracking data can serve as valuable documentation in the event of disputes or audits. A clear record of work performed provides a solid foundation for resolving conflicts and protecting your business interests.

Utilizing Data for Performance Reviews

Beyond project-specific accountability, time tracking data can also be used to inform employee performance reviews. By analyzing individual time records, managers can identify areas where employees excel and areas where they may need additional support or training. This data-driven approach to performance management is more objective and fair than relying solely on subjective impressions. For example, if an employee consistently takes longer than average to complete certain tasks, it may indicate a need for additional training or a mismatch between their skills and their assigned responsibilities. Conversely, if an employee consistently delivers high-quality work within budget, it is a clear indication of their value to the organization. Leveraging time tracking data for performance reviews promotes continuous improvement and fosters a culture of accountability.

The Role of Automation in Time Tracking

Manual time tracking methods are susceptible to human error and can be incredibly time-consuming. Automation, however, can significantly streamline the process, reducing administrative overhead and improving accuracy. Automated time tracking tools can integrate with calendars, email clients, and other applications to automatically capture time spent on various tasks. For instance, a tool can detect when an employee is actively working on a project file and automatically start tracking their time. Similarly, a tool can analyze email communications to identify time spent on client interactions or project-related discussions. This level of automation not only saves time but also ensures that all work hours are accurately accounted for. The time saved can then be reallocated to more strategic activities, such as project planning, client relationship management, or business development.

Addressing Common Challenges in Time Tracking Implementation

Implementing a new time tracking system can present certain challenges. One common obstacle is resistance from employees who may perceive time tracking as a form of micromanagement. To overcome this, it's crucial to communicate the benefits of time tracking clearly and transparently, emphasizing how it can help improve project outcomes, streamline workflows, and ultimately benefit the entire team. Another challenge is ensuring data accuracy and consistency. It's important to provide adequate training to employees on how to use the time tracking tool effectively and to establish clear guidelines for time entry. Regular audits of time records can also help identify and correct any errors or inconsistencies. Finally, selecting the right time tracking tool is critical. Consider your specific needs and requirements, and choose a tool that integrates seamlessly with your existing systems and workflows.
